Show Notes

Caesar Kalinowski is an author, speaker and coach. Today, Caesar shares how he discovered the gospel that really is good news for the weary. He shares the story of how he got into full time ministry, how he served an elderly neighbor, and overcoming doubt in his daily life. Caesar’s story reminds us how important it is to live in community and to experience the grace of God from one another.

Great quotes from Caesar:

Discipleship is, in fact, the mission.

Discipleship is the process of moving from unbelief to belief in every area of life.

Treat people like family instead of guests and they’ll act like family.
